SEALINK KANGAROO ISLAND

Boat and ferry
5/5
1 review

Sealink provides a sea link between Kangaroo Island (Pennesshaw) and the mainland (Cape Jervis) as well as land shuttles between Penneshaw, Kingscote and American River, and between Adelaide and Cape Jervis. The company also offers tours ranging from one to several days on Kangaroo Island from Adelaide, Fleurieu Peninsula and Cape Jervis. The opportunity to admire the Remarkable Rocks, Admirals Arch, Cape Couedic lighthouse, the Bay of the Sea Lions; to walk through Flinders Chase National Park and to see koalas.

ADELAIDE PARKLANDS TERMINAL

Train

It is the interstate (interregional) railway station whose former name is Keswik Station. Beware, the distances are important and the trips long! You can find the departures and arrivals of the following trains:

The Overland (Adelaide-Melbourne). Approximately 10h30 of travel.

The Indian Pacific (Perth-Adelaide-Sydney). Approximately 43 hours for Perth. Approximately 26 hours for Sydney.

The Ghan (Adelaide-Alice Springs-Darwin). About 23h for Alice Springs. About 2 days to Darwin.

ADELAIDE RAILWAY STATION

Railway station

This station, which dates back to 1928, is the departure point for commuter trains (note that Intersate trains leave from the Adelaide Parklands Terminal). Since 1985, the overhead section has become the Adelaide Casino.

Adelaide Railways Station Infocentre. At the same location, this is one of two public transport information centers in Adelaide. Another is located in the city center, Currie Street Infocentre. Information on commuter trains, buses and streetcars, timetables, fares and possible passes...

ADELAIDE O-BAHN

Public transport buses and coaches

The O-Bahn line, designed by the German company Daimler-Benz, is a bus line with part of its route on an impassable track (with low concrete walls on both sides). It was established in 1986 to relieve traffic congestion in the northeastern suburbs and provide quick access to the Tea Tree Plaza shopping area. It is 12 kilometers long and has three stops from Currie Street or Grenfell Street in downtown Adelaide: Klemzig Station, Paradise Interchange and Tea Tree Plaza Interchange.

KINGSCOTE AIRPORT

Airport and passenger services

Kangaroo Island airport is served by Qantas. You'll find a small café there. Cabs and shuttles are available to take you to the city center or vice versa. Kangaroo Island Transfer provides a shuttle service from the airport. Reservations are required. Rental cars are also available on site: Hertz and Budget are among the car rental companies present (but remember to book in advance for the best rates and options).
